Ryerson’s campus will be transformed into a hub of social justice art exhibits, film screenings, walking tours and lectures during the third annual Social Justice Week from Oct. 7 to 11.
Social Justice Week features dozens of speakers, activists, exhibits and cultural performances that will turn the campus into a platform for discussion of social justice issues and community building in Toronto. Organizers work closely with the diverse groups that represent students, faculty and staff across the campus in the planning and programming of the Week.
